Definitions of "Sweet mout"


1. Sweet mout


English Translation

smooth talker


Definition

In Jamaican Patois, "sweet mout" is a term used to describe someone who speaks in a flattering or insincere manner, often with the intention of manipulating or gaining favor from others. It can also refer to someone who is overly talkative or gossipy.


Example Sentences

Patois: Hm a sweet mout, watch him
English: He's a smooth talker, watch him
